If you only remember one thing: in Belgium, a TV subscription ranking changes completely depending on whether you rank on the first-year price or on the thirteenth bill. I rank on the second. Proximus comes first because it is the only operator covering the whole country with the same package and the same set-top box, and because its promo-to-full-price gap is the most legible on the market. Telenet and VOO follow, each dominating its half of the country: Telenet in the north, VOO in Wallonia and Brussels. Orange places fourth with the most flexible offer for households that do not want a landline. Scarlet and Base close the ranking: fewer channels, fewer options, but a markedly lower full price, which makes them the only offers whose bill does not jump after a year. None of these six is best in the abstract: the only question that matters before choosing is which of them actually serves your address.
